Christian Benteke notched a brace on his 26th birthday and Crystal Palace snapped a six-game losing streak with their 3-0 victory over Southampton on Saturday at Selhurst Park.Benteke opened the scoring in the 33rd minute, and the Eagles (4-2-8) quickly added another three minutes later when James Tomkins took advantage of some shoddy Saints work defending a set piece-corner. Benteke, the high-priced striker who came over from Liverpool, had not scored at home all season but added his second goal there to secure the victory in the 85th minute off another corner and nifty set-up from Jason Puncheon.The victory also ended a seven-match winless slide for Palace, who had not won since beating Sunderland 3-2 on Sept. 24.It was certainly a disappointing effort for Southampton (4-5-5), who had won two in a row, including 2-0 over Arsenal in EFL Cup play this week. The Saints recorded 19 shots but only three were on target. Theyve managed three goals and been shut out three times during a 1-2-3 Premier League stretch.Palace, meanwhile, earned their first clean sheet of the league campaign. Rugby league star Greg Bird has been fined for drunkenly refusing to leave a Byron Bay hotel in northern NSW.The former Gold Coast forward, who a week ago left the Titans to join French side Catalans in the English Super League, has copped a $550 penalty over the September 17 incident.Police last month claimed Bird and his group were asked to leave the premises because of their levels of intoxication, alleging a brawl had broken out with security staff.Its alleged a 32-year-old man was asked to leave a licensed premises by security staff but failed to comply, NSW police said in a statement to AAP on Tuesday.The man was assisted out of the location by a friend with no further incident.He was issued an infringement notice including thhe fine on Monday.ddddddddddddBird previously claimed he would be exonerated over the incident.I left the premises(s) and someone from our party stayed and got into a physical altercation with the security, he wrote on Instagram in September.Me along with everyone else in the group ran into (sic) separate the two involved and no-one else threw any punches.There is footage and witnesses to verify this.Bird played 129 games for the Gold Coast, as well as 18 Origin games for NSW and 17 Tests, but was dropped from both representative sides this year.He has joined the French-based Catalans on a five-year deal.
